What is a Rising Sign?
Before exploring career impact, it is important to understand what is a rising sign. The rising sign meaning refers to the zodiac sign that was rising on the eastern horizon at the time of your birth.
Many people also ask what is rising sign or whats a rising sign in astrology. Simply put, it represents your outer personality, first impressions, and how others perceive you professionally and socially.
Sometimes it is also referred to as the rising sun sign, and it plays an important role in shaping your professional identity.

How Your Moon Sign Impacts Your Career Growth
Your Moon sign describes your emotional nature and reactions. It determines how you deal with stress, what motivates you, and which environments make you feel comfortable and productive.
Here’s how different Moon elements influence career choices:
Fire Moon (Aries, Leo, Sagittarius)
You shine in energetic and fast-paced environments. Leadership roles, entrepreneurship, sports, or entertainment industries can be great options.
Earth Moon (Taurus, Virgo, Capricorn)
You prefer stability and structure. Careers in finance, healthcare, administration, or management provide the stability you need.
Air Moon (Gemini, Libra, Aquarius)
Communication and intellectual stimulation are important to you. You often excel in writing, media, public relations, technology, or teaching.
Water Moon (Cancer, Scorpio, Pisces)
You are emotionally intuitive and creative. This makes you well-suited for counseling, psychology, social work, healing professions, or artistic fields.
